当前位置:首页 / Word

Word文档如何拆分成独立文件?如何实现批量操作?

作者:佚名|分类:Word|浏览:172|发布时间:2025-04-02 02:37:07

Word文档如何拆分成独立文件?批量操作指南

随着工作量的增加,我们经常需要将一个大的Word文档拆分成多个独立的文件,以便于管理和分发。下面,我将详细介绍如何将Word文档拆分成独立文件,并介绍如何实现批量操作。

一、手动拆分Word文档

1. 打开Word文档

首先,打开你想要拆分的Word文档。

2. 定位拆分位置

在文档中找到你想要拆分的位置。例如,你可以选择章节标题、页码或其他任何你想要作为分割点的位置。

3. 插入分节符

在“开始”选项卡中,点击“页面布局”组中的“分节符”按钮,选择合适的分节符类型。例如,如果你想要在章节标题后拆分文档,可以选择“下一页”类型的分节符。

4. 保存拆分后的文档

在插入分节符后,你可以看到文档被分成了两部分。将光标放在第一部分文档的开始位置,点击“文件”菜单,选择“另存为”,给第一部分文档命名并保存。

5. 重复步骤

重复以上步骤,直到将整个文档拆分成独立的文件。

二、使用宏实现批量操作

如果你需要频繁进行文档拆分,手动操作可能会比较繁琐。这时,你可以使用宏来实现批量操作。

1. 打开Word文档

打开你想要拆分的Word文档。

2. 记录宏

按下“Alt + F8”键,打开“宏”对话框。点击“录制新宏”按钮,给宏命名,并选择一个快捷键(如果需要的话)。

3. 拆分文档

在宏录制状态下,按照手动拆分的步骤进行操作。例如,插入分节符、保存文档等。

4. 停止录制宏

完成拆分操作后,按下“Alt + F8”键,在“宏”对话框中点击“停止录制”按钮。

5. 运行宏

在“宏”对话框中,选择你刚刚录制的宏,点击“运行”按钮。Word会自动按照宏中的步骤拆分文档。

三、使用VBA脚本实现批量操作

如果你熟悉VBA编程,可以使用VBA脚本实现更灵活的批量操作。

1. 打开Word文档

打开你想要拆分的Word文档。

2. 打开VBA编辑器

按下“Alt + F11”键,打开VBA编辑器。

3. 创建新模块

在VBA编辑器中,右键点击“VBAProject(你的文档名)”,选择“插入” -> “模块”,创建一个新模块。

4. 编写VBA脚本

在模块中,输入以下VBA脚本:

```vba

Sub SplitDocument()

Dim doc As Document

Dim section As Section

Dim i As Integer

Set doc = ActiveDocument

i = 1

For Each section In doc.Sections

section.Range.InsertBreak Type:=wdPageBreak

section.Range.SaveAs Filename:="拆分文档" & i & ".docx", FileFormat:=wdFormatXMLDocument

i = i + 1

Next section

End Sub

```

5. 运行VBA脚本

关闭VBA编辑器,回到Word文档。按下“Alt + F8”键,在“宏”对话框中,选择你刚刚编写的宏,点击“运行”按钮。

四、相关问答

1. 问:如何将Word文档中的表格拆分成独立文件?

答: 将表格拆分成独立文件的方法与拆分普通文本类似。首先,选中表格,然后插入分节符,接着将表格保存为新的Word文档。

2. 问:如何将Word文档中的图片拆分成独立文件?

答: 将图片拆分成独立文件需要使用VBA脚本。在VBA编辑器中,编写一个循环遍历文档中的所有图片,并将每个图片保存为新的文件。

3. 问:如何将Word文档中的目录拆分成独立文件?

答: 将目录拆分成独立文件的方法与拆分普通文本类似。首先,选中目录,然后插入分节符,接着将目录保存为新的Word文档。

4. 问:如何将Word文档中的脚注或尾注拆分成独立文件?

答: 将脚注或尾注拆分成独立文件的方法与拆分普通文本类似。首先,选中脚注或尾注,然后插入分节符,接着将脚注或尾注保存为新的Word文档。

通过以上方法,你可以轻松地将Word文档拆分成独立的文件,并实现批量操作。希望这篇文章能帮助你解决实际问题。